Nanoplasmonic biosensing for soft matter adsorption : kinetics of lipid vesicle attachment and shape deformation
An indirect nanoplasmonic sensing platform is reported for investigating the kinetics of attachment and shape deformation associated with lipid vesicle adsorption onto a titanium oxide-coated substrate.
